The Lempel-Ziv-Welch (LZW) algorithm provides loss-less data compression. It effectively compresses repetitive data and does so with minimal computational overhead. Fractal algorithms convert these parts into mathematical data called "fractal codes" which are used to recreate the encoded image. There’s a reason you don’t have the option to export to that in Lightroom: LZW does not work at all well with 16-bit files and often makes them larger. Při kompresi a dekompresi si pouze vytváří pomocný seznam frází. 1-, 8-, and 24-bit images allcompress at least as well as they do using RLEencoding schemes. LZW (Lempel-Ziv-Welch) is a universal lossless data compression algorithm created by Abraham Lempel, Jacob Ziv, and Terry Welch. LZ77 (Lempel-Ziv 77) ist ein verlustloses Verfahren zur Datenkompression, das 1977 von Abraham Lempel und Jacob Ziv veröffentlicht wurde. El diccionario comienza pre-cargado con 256 entradas, una para cada carácter (byte) posible más un código predefinido para indicar el fin de archivo. L'algorithme LZW avait été breveté par la société Unisys [1] (un brevet logiciel valable uniquement aux États-Unis). Nótese que cada carácter leído genera una nueva entrada en el diccionario, independientemente de si se utilizará o no. JBIG2 ist ein Verfahren zur Bildkompression von Binärbildern für sowohl verlustfreie als auch verlustbehaftete Kompression. Que el tamaño de los índices pueda ser incrementado de manera variable es una de las contribuciones de Welch. compress (/usr/bin/compress) ist ein Packprogramm unter UNIXen und UNIX-ähnlichen Betriebssystemen.Seine Funktion wie auch sein Verhalten ist im POSIX-Standard (und damit auch in der Single UNIX Specification und der Norm IEEE 1003.1) festgelegt. Lempel-Ziv-Welch (abbreviato LZW) un algoritmo utilizzato in informatica per la compressione dati senza perdita di informazioni . … Die Spezifikation des CCP wurde mit RFC 1962 im Juni 1996 veröffentlicht und ist ein IETF Standard. LZW compression works by reading a sequence of symbols, grouping the symbols into strings, and converting the strings into codes. En realidad, el algoritmo no discrimina entre códigos y caracteres simples pues el diccionario se carga inicialmente de códigos que representan los primeros 256 caracteres simples por lo que estos no son más que otros códigos dentro del mismo diccionario. Todos los caracteres están inicialmente predefinidos en el diccionario así que siempre habrá al menos una coincidencia, sin embargo, lo que se busca es la cadena más larga posible. Since the decompression process is always one step behind the compression process, there is the possibility when the decoder find a code which is not in the dictionary. LSB-First is less intuitive but I found it can run faster than MSB-First, and it seemed easier to implement. Il s'agit d'une amélioration de l'algorithme LZ78 inventé par Abraham Lempel et Jacob Ziv en 1978. At the time, CompuServe was not aware of the patent. El LZ78 estaba bajo la patente 4,464,650, pedida por Lempel, Ziv, Cohn y Eastman y asignada a Sperry Corporation, más tarde Unisys Corporation, el 10 de agosto de 1981. Bildkompression beruht wie jede Anwendung der Datenkompression darauf, die ursprünglichen Daten entweder in eine vollständig rekonstruierbare Form zu überführen, die weniger Speicherplatz benötigt oder Daten zu entfernen, deren Verlust kaum wahrnehmbar ist. Reading: https://en.wikipedia.org/wiki/Lempel%E2%80%93Ziv%E2%80%93Welch More reading of wikipedia as I journey on my quest to create a PNG decoder and encoder. De acuerdo con una declaración en la web de Unisys, las patentes de LZW en el Reino Unido, Francia, Alemania, Italia y Japón han expirado en junio de 2004 y la patente canadiense en julio de 2004. Para esto serían necesarios códigos de 9 bits, lo cual quiere decir que aún hay disponibles 255 códigos de 9 bits para representar cadenas de caracteres. El algoritmo preve que, cuando una cadena fuera a forzar la ampliación del diccionario a 17 bits, el diccionario se borre por completo, se inicialice nuevamente con los 256 códigos iniciales más el código de fin de archivo y se recomience el proceso. La compresión de imagen puede ser con pérdida (Lossy) o sin pérdida (LossLess).. En la codificación sin pérdida se puede transmitir una imagen utilizando compresión sin pérdida de información sobre un protocolo de transmisión con pérdida como UDP. The last compression option, 16-bit LZW compression, is added mostly as a cautionary tale. LZW, LZC, LZT, LZMW, LZJ, LZFG. You may have to register before you can post: click the register link above to proceed. El método llegó a ser utilizado de forma moderada, pero en toda su amplitud en el programa compress que llegó a ser más o menos la utilidad estándar de compresión en sistemas Unix alrededor de 1986 (ahora ha desaparecido prácticamente tanto por asuntos legales como técnicos). Teile wurden mit dem RFC 2153 im Mai 1997 überarbeitet. Das Compression Control Protocol (CCP) ist ein Netzwerkprotokoll und wird verwendet, um innerhalb einer Point-to-Point Verbindung (PPP) die Datenkompression zwischen den Verbindungspartnern auszuhandeln. האלגוריתם LZW או Lempel-Ziv-Welch פותח על ידי אברהם למפל, יעקב זיו וטרי ולך. La clave del método LZW reside en que es posible crear sobre la marcha, de manera automática y en una única pasada un diccionario de cadenas que se encuentren dentro del texto a comprimir mientras al mismo tiempo se procede a su codificación. Teknik compression iku uwis dipaténaké ing taun 1985. Einige Detailverbesserungen wurden 1983 von Terry A. Welch gemacht. En tanto los caracteres sucesivos que se vayan leyendo ofrezcan más de una entrada posible en el diccionario, se siguen leyendo caracteres. Image1 lzw.svg 800 × 600; 6 KB. It was published by Welch in 1984 as an improved implementation of the LZ78 algorithm published by Lempel and Ziv in 1978. You can read a complete description of it in the Wikipedia article on the subject. The LZW algorithm is an efficient way of generating the code table based on the particular data being compressed. Otra característica importante del algoritmo es que los códigos en la salida se representan por cadenas de bits variables. Lempel–Ziv–Welch (LZW) is a universal lossless data compression algorithm created by Abraham Lempel, Jacob Ziv, and Terry Welch.It was published by Welch in 1984 as an improved implementation of the LZ78 algorithm published by Lempel and Ziv in 1978. and we're actually going to use the TST so that we'll have to worry about the extra space. Del 28 en adelante cada código representa más de un carácter. Der Lempel-Ziv-Welch-Algorithmus (kurz LZW-Algorithmus oder LZW genannt) ist ein häufig bei Grafikformaten zur Datenkompression, also zur Reduzierung der Datenmenge, eingesetzter Algorithmus.Ein Großteil der Funktionsweise dieses Algorithmus wurden 1978 von Abraham Lempel und Jacob Ziv entwickelt und veröffentlicht ().Einige Detailverbesserungen wurden 1983 von Terry A. LZW (Lempel-Ziv-Welch) is a popular compression algorithm used by a number of formats, including GIF, TIFF, PostScript, PDF, Unix Compress, and V.42bis. LZW (Lempel-Ziv-Welch) es un algoritmo de compresión sin pérdida desarrollado por Terry Welch en 1984 como una versión mejorada del algoritmo LZ78 desarrollado por Abraham Lempel y Jacob Ziv Descripción del algoritmo. Az LZW széles körben a Unix operációs rendszer compress segédprogramjának algoritmusaként terjedt el; ma leginkább a GIF képformátum részeként ismert. Adviértase que el código en si no se almacena en la tabla sino que es el índice de la misma por lo cual no se almacena sino que se calcula por la posición en la tabla. Los códigos del 1 al 26 se corresponden con caracteres simples 1 = A, 2 = B, ... 26 = Z y 27 = "fin de archivo". In other words, if your data does not compresswell in its present form, … The purpose of TIFF is to describe and store raster image data. In genere comprime grandi testi in lingua inglese a circa la metà delle loro dimensioni originali. This is often the case with text and monochrome images. ב- Zip, Unzip ממומש האלגוריתם LZH, ב- Unix Compress ממומש LZW ו- LZC גרסאות של LZ78. Article LZW in Catalan Wikipedia has 21.6484 points for quality, 107 points for popularity and points for Authors’ Interest (AI) (By the way, that shows that English is not a normal number.) LZW compression is the compression of a file into a smaller file using a table-based lookup algorithm invented by Abraham Lempel, Jacob Ziv, and Terry Welch. Dicho diccionario no es transmitido con el texto comprimido, puesto que el descompresor puede reconstruirlo usando la misma lógica con que lo hace el compresor y, si está codificado correctamente, tendrá exactamente las mismas cadenas que el diccionario del compresor tenía. La compañía finalizó esas licencias en agosto de 1999. LZW compression. Today's Posts; Member List; Calendar; Forum; Program; Support; If this is your first visit, be sure to check out the FAQ by clicking the link above. Ein Großteil der Funktionsweise dieses Algorithmus wurden 1978 von Abraham Lempel und Jacob Ziv entwickelt und veröffentlicht (LZ78). Several compression algorithms based on this principle, differing mainly in the manner in which they manage the dictionary. LZW Compression 2. and encodes the inputdata as a number that rep-resents its index in the dictionary. Otras utilidades de compresión también utilizan este método u otros relativamente cercanos. Para interpretarla, se sugiere ignorar la representación binaria, que se incluye simplemente para contabilizar el tamaño del archivo de salida. There's no reason to list the source code of CodeWriter and CodeReader here. i.e. The Bottom Line Note: The input array is supposed to be the result of applying the LZW compression algorithm. The most well-known scheme (in fact the most well-known of all the Lempel-Ziv compressors is Terry Welch's LZW scheme, developed in 1984. LZW compression is fast. Diese Seite wurde zuletzt am 20. See the Wikipedia article on LZW for more information on packing order. The Lempel-Ziv-Welch (LZW) algorithm provides loss-less data compression. The LZW algorithm is a lossless data compression algorithm created by Terry Welch in 1984. Lossless compression is a class of data compression algorithms that allows the original data to be perfectly reconstructed from the compressed data. LZW (pour Lempel-Ziv-Welch) est un algorithme de compression de données sans perte. LZW fut créé en 1984 par Terry Welch, d'où son nom. Otra de ellas fue especificar una estructura de datos eficiente para guardar el diccionario. LZW compression is best ... A normal number cannot be compressed. TIFF is not a printer language or page description language. La patente estadounidense 4,558,302 es la que ha causado la mayor controversia. La compressione LZW fornisce uno dei migliori livelli di compressione, in molte applicazioni, rispetto a qualsiasi metodo ben noto a disposizione fino a quel momento. It then reads data 8 bits at a time (e.g., ’a’, ’b’, etc.) Post your remarks or questions about IrfanView here. again very simple implementation for such a sophisticated algorithm, really. Skočit na navigaci Skočit na ... (PKZIP 0.x a 1.x), unixovém komprimačním programu compress (soubory s příponou „Z“), grafickém formátu GIF a dokumentech PDF. En total, una tabla llena ocupa 65536 entradas de 4 bytes cada una, o sea 262144 caracteres (256 kbytes) lo que es absurdamente poco para los ordenadores actuales. LZW compression works best for files containing lots of repetitive data. 0000055906 00000 n It won't do all the work for you, but can easily decode ROT13 codes, and help you in breaking This compression ratio calculator can be used to work out the compression ratio of your engine. Las entradas del diccionario pueden representar secuencias de caracteres simples o secuencias de códigos de tal forma que un código puede representar dos caracteres o puede representar secuencias de otros códigos previamente cargados que a su vez representen, cada uno de ellos, otros códigos o caracteres simples, o sea que un código puede representar desde uno a un número indeterminado de caracteres. Se usó ampliamente desde que se convirtió en parte del formato gráfico GIF en 1987. LZW (Lempel-Ziv-Welch) es un algoritmo de compresión sin pérdida desarrollado por Terry Welch en 1984 como una versión mejorada del algoritmo LZ78 desarrollado por Abraham Lempel y Jacob Ziv. You can read a complete description of it in the Wikipedia article on the subject. Sad day ... GIF patent dead at 20 (Article curt i possiblement amb una simplificació de la veritable història; es pot trobar quelcom més detallada a la pàgina de GIF). LZW fut créé en 1984 par Terry Welch, d'où son nom. Removing noisefrom an image, usually by zeroing out one or two of the leastsignificant bit planes of the image, is recommended to increasecompression efficiency. This algorithm represents an improved version of the LZ78 algorithm created by Abraham Lempel and Jacob Ziv in 1978. Cuando se completan estas 512 entradas, se agrega un bit y se disponen de 1024 nuevas entradas y así sucesivamente. I do not want understand LZW how to work? (Wikipedia) This app takes simple string and returns its output table, string table and compression ration using the LZW algorithm. In computing, Deflate is a lossless data compression file format that uses a combination of LZSS and Huffman coding.It was designed by Phil Katz, for version 2 of his PKZIP archiving tool. When encoding begins the code table contains only the first 256 entries, with the remainder of … I am wondering about data integrity of uncompressed TIFF files that were previously LZW files. "LZW Data Compression", by Mark Nelson (DDJ Article amb codi font). And understand this may be a complex issue. Die Datenkompression (wohl lehnübersetzt und eingedeutscht aus dem englischen ‚ data compression ‘) – auch (weiter eingedeutscht) Datenkomprimierung genannt – ist ein Vorgang, bei dem die Menge digitaler Daten verdichtet oder reduziert wird. Copyright © 2021 Linden Research, Inc. Deflate was later specified in RFC 1951 (1996).. Katz also designed the original algorithm used to construct Deflate streams. The algorithm is simple to implement and has the potential for very high throughput in hardware implementations. gzip ist ein freies Kompressionsprogramm, das, ebenso wie das entsprechende Dateiformat gzip, praktisch für alle Computerbetriebssysteme verfügbar ist (unter den Bedingungen der GPL auch im Quelltext).. Allgemein ist gzip die Kurzform für „GNU zip“, wobei „zip“ vom englischen Wort für den Reißverschluss entlehnt wurde. Muchos expertos en leyes concluyen que la patente no cubre dispositivos que sólo descompriman LZW y no puedan comprimir datos usándolo, por esta razón el popular programa Gzip puede leer archivos .Z pero no escribirlos. It was patented, but it … images and LZW compression. Cada vez que se lee un nuevo carácter se revisa el diccionario para ver si forma parte de alguna entrada previa. A primary goal of TIFF is to provide a rich environment within which applica- tions can exchange image data. This links for Huffman Compression : https://goo.gl/5BA7TVAdaptive Huffman : https://youtu.be/3_ftuCZGM04 Several compression algorithms based on this principle, differing mainly in the manner in which they manage the dictionary. Dos patentes de los Estados Unidos fueron creadas para el LZW: la patente de EE.UU. It is based on LZ77 and LZ78, methods developed by Abraham Lempel and Jacob Ziv in the 1970s, and was later refined into LZW by Terry Welch. The algorithm is simple to implement and has the potential for very high throughput in hardware implementations. Download LZW Compressor - An easy-to-use compression and decompression application that provides support for multiple algorithms, such as LZW, Huffman, Arithmetic, or others LZW does a very good job of compressing image datawith a wide variety of pixel depths. A typical use of this method would be similar to: Because the codes take up less space than the strings they replace, we get compression.Characteristic features of LZW includes, LZW compression uses a code table, with 4096 as a common choice for the number of table entries.